Reusing and Reuse Methods
While demolition jobs frequently produce substantial waste, carrying out recycling and reuse strategies can greatly alleviate ecological influence. Lots of demolition professionals are currently taking on methods that focus on the recovery of materials such as concrete, glass, steel, and wood. By sorting and processing these products on-site, service providers can draw away considerable amounts from landfills. Recovered materials can be repurposed for brand-new building tasks, minimizing the demand for virgin sources and decreasing overall task prices. Additionally, utilizing recycled products frequently enhances the sustainability account of new structures. Engaging a demolition contractor with a solid dedication to recycling and reuse not only adds to ecological stewardship however additionally supports neighborhood economic climates by supplying products for other building ventures.
Dangerous Material Disposal
Along with reusing and reuse methods, dealing with unsafe materials is an essential aspect of accountable demolition techniques. Contractors need to determine and take care of materials such as asbestos, lead, or chemicals that position wellness threats. Reliable dangerous product disposal calls for proper training, qualification, and adherence to neighborhood regulations. A qualified demolition contractor must possess a comprehensive understanding of safe handling and disposal methods, including using customized devices and containment procedures. In addition, they need to offer paperwork to assure compliance with environmental requirements. Involving a specialist with a strong waste management strategy not only reduces dangers yet likewise shows dedication to lasting methods. This approach ultimately safeguards public health and wellness and lessens ecological effect throughout demolition tasks.

What Types of Insurance Should a Demolition Specialist Have?
A demolition professional ought to have several kinds of insurance, including basic liability, employees' settlement, and contamination responsibility insurance coverage. These insurance policies safeguard against potential crashes, injuries, and ecological damages throughout the demolition procedure, guaranteeing complete threat administration.
